Gameplay Summary

The game started with all players developing their boards and ramping mana, with early plays including Will and Lucas playing their commanders and key ramp elements, while others set up their strategies with mana dorks and utility creatures.

Early interactions centered around setting up the board state, including the use of Chromox and Rocco, Cabaretti Caterer to generate value and combos with returning creatures.

Yuriko, the Tiger's Shadow, quickly began to pressure players with ninja attacks and triggered abilities that dealt damage and drew cards, setting the tone for an aggressive, evasive strategy.

Alela, Artful Provocateur focused on locking down the board with token generation and control elements, aiming to overwhelm opponents with fairies and enchantment synergies.

Rocco's deck revolved around food token generation and leveraging creature return abilities to maintain board presence and value, creating incremental advantages through combat and sacrifice triggers. Midgame saw a pivotal moment when players began to cycle through cards rapidly, using wheels and draw spells to refill hands and find key pieces.

The use of Dark Ritual and mana artifacts like Mox Opal accelerated explosive plays, allowing for multiple spells and triggers in a turn.

Combat phases became tense with Yuriko executing multiple unblockable ninja strikes, triggering damage and card draw effects that pressured opponents heavily.

The interactions between commanders and their synergies started to surface more clearly, with Alela's fairies bolstering board control and Rocco's recursion enabling sustained threats.

The game progressed with players balancing between building their board state and disrupting opponents, setting the stage for a potential explosive finish through combo or overwhelming board presence.
